2023 CHF to NGN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2023

During 2023, the CHF to NGN ex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 30, valuing the pair at 1068.2507.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on January 5, dropping to 479.0331.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 589.2176 NGN.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 492.0117 to the December average rate of 938.3674, the exchange rate registered a net change of 90.72%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2023 high of 1068.2507 was up 120.41% compared to the 2022 peak of 484.6555,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 529.8804, compared to 887.8654 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 357.9850 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2023 was June, with a trading range of 410.5594 NGN (High: 917.7074 / Low: 507.1480). On the other end, May was the most stable month, with a tight range of 14.7573 NGN (High: 521.3794 / Low: 506.6221).
